The Abduction That Changed Everything: Sonny Crosses the Final Line

In a move that stunned even those closest to him, Sonny Corinthos made a reckless, incendiary decision that’s rapidly redefining who he is—and who he’s becoming. Marco, son of the elusive and dangerous Sidwell, was kidnapped by Sonny himself. This wasn’t a power play. It wasn’t a strategy. It was an act of unfiltered rage—an emotional outburst disguised as retaliation.

This is the same Sonny who once held to a strict code. Family came first. Innocents were off-limits. But the fire at Charlie’s Pub, Kristina’s near-death, and Sidwell’s psychological warfare have stripped him bare. He isn’t thinking like a mob boss anymore—he’s thinking like a father pushed past the point of no return.

With Marco held hostage, a line has been crossed. A declaration has been made. Sonny’s personal war is now public. And the aftershocks of his decision are pulling every major player in Port Charles into a storm no one knows how to stop.
